From infinitely recyclable aluminum cans and cups to aerosol bottles, our goal is to contribute to a better community, society, and world.** **Key Responsibilities:** * Operate workstation equipment using specific control panels to maximize equipment productivity and the quality of manufactured cans; * Change labels by replacing printing plates, blankets, and inks, then perform all necessary adjustments to ensure the quality of manufactured cans; * Conduct routine inspections to detect equipment anomalies based on TPM operational check\-lists, and perform mechanical interventions whenever necessary to ensure full equipment functionality; * Perform workstation quality inspection routines using an automated system, making interventions to correct and maintain can parameters within specifications, and flagging the need for corrections to upstream workstations; * Perform minor corrective and preventive maintenance activities (e.g., hose replacement, ink roller replacement, scrapers, suction cups, mandrels, etc.) and low-complexity adjustments (e.g., ink fountain pressure, feed wheel synchronization, varnish weight and overlap, etc.). **What We Are Looking For:** **Required** * Technical deg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electromechanical Engineering, or Mechatronics; * Industrial experience. **Additional Information:** * **Work Location:** Extrema/MG * **Work Model:** On-site * **Working Hours:** 7 a.m. to 7 p.m. or 7 p.m. to 7 a.m., rotating 4x4 schedule **Ball Corporation is an equal opportunity employer.
